|
|
@@ -240,6 +240,22 @@ function siteBuilder_SuspendAccount($params) {
|
|
|
return 'Error: ' . $response['error_msg'];
|
|
|
}
|
|
|
}
|
|
|
+ try {
|
|
|
+ Capsule::table('sitePro_acc')
|
|
|
+ ->where('account',$params['username'])
|
|
|
+ ->update(array(
|
|
|
+ 'enabled' => false,
|
|
|
+ ));
|
|
|
+ } catch (\Exception $e) {
|
|
|
+ logModuleCall(
|
|
|
+ 'siteBuilder',
|
|
|
+ __FUNCTION__,
|
|
|
+ $params,
|
|
|
+ 'Error: could remove account from database',
|
|
|
+ $e->getMessage()
|
|
|
+ );
|
|
|
+ return 'Error: could remove account from database';
|
|
|
+ }
|
|
|
return 'success';
|
|
|
}
|
|
|
|
|
|
@@ -257,6 +273,22 @@ function siteBuilder_SuspendAccount($params) {
|
|
|
* @return string 'success' or an error message
|
|
|
*/
|
|
|
function siteBuilder_UnsuspendAccount($params) {
|
|
|
+ try {
|
|
|
+ Capsule::table('sitePro_acc')
|
|
|
+ ->where('account',$params['username'])
|
|
|
+ ->update(array(
|
|
|
+ 'enabled' => true,
|
|
|
+ ));
|
|
|
+ } catch (\Exception $e) {
|
|
|
+ logModuleCall(
|
|
|
+ 'siteBuilder',
|
|
|
+ __FUNCTION__,
|
|
|
+ $params,
|
|
|
+ 'Error: could remove account from database',
|
|
|
+ $e->getMessage()
|
|
|
+ );
|
|
|
+ return 'Error: could remove account from database';
|
|
|
+ }
|
|
|
return 'success';
|
|
|
}
|
|
|
|